Analysis
In 2021, electricity production from renewable sources, excluding in Cape Verde stood at 14.39 % change on previous year.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 197.1% on the previous year and down 97.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, electricity production from renewable sources, excluding in Cape Verde peaked at 499.27 % change on previous year in 2011 and was at its lowest, -19.8 % change on previous year, in 2008.
That places Cape Verde 73rd out of 206 countries with data for 2021, putting it in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
The year-on-year percentage change in Electricity production from renewable sources, excluding hydroelectric (kWh).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
Computed from
- Electricity production from renewable sources, excluding hydroelectric IEA Energy Statistics Data Browser, International Energy Agency (IEA)
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
